Skip to content

Commit

Permalink
Второй или третий откат изменений с музыкой
Browse files Browse the repository at this point in the history
  • Loading branch information
Exapsters committed Nov 5, 2023
1 parent a9ac33f commit dd87e4c
Show file tree
Hide file tree
Showing 23 changed files with 24 additions and 60 deletions.
1 change: 0 additions & 1 deletion code/controllers/subsystems/ticker.dm
Original file line number Diff line number Diff line change
Expand Up @@ -170,7 +170,6 @@ SUBSYSTEM_DEF(ticker)
var/datum/job/job = SSjobs.get_by_title(H.mind.assigned_role)
if(job && job.create_record)
CreateModularRecord(H)
sound_to(H, pick(H.mind.assigned_job.intro_music))

callHook("roundstart")

Expand Down
2 changes: 0 additions & 2 deletions code/game/jobs/job/job.dm
Original file line number Diff line number Diff line change
Expand Up @@ -55,8 +55,6 @@

var/required_language

var/intro_music = list() //prox

/datum/job/New()

if(prob(100-availablity_chance)) //Close positions, blah blah.
Expand Down
12 changes: 0 additions & 12 deletions maps/torch/job/command_jobs.dm
Original file line number Diff line number Diff line change
Expand Up @@ -26,8 +26,6 @@
/datum/computer_file/program/camera_monitor,
/datum/computer_file/program/reports)

intro_music = list('proxima/sound/intro/captain1.ogg')

/datum/job/captain/get_description_blurb()
return "Вы - Командующий офицер (КО). Вы - первый человек на борту судна. \
Вы опытный профессиональный офицер, контролирующий всё судно и в конечном счете несущий ответственность за все, что происходит на борту. \
Expand Down Expand Up @@ -138,8 +136,6 @@
/datum/computer_file/program/camera_monitor,
/datum/computer_file/program/reports)

intro_music = list('proxima/sound/intro/rd1.ogg')

/datum/job/rd/get_description_blurb()
return "Вы - Главный научный офицер (ГНО). Вы ответственны за работу научно-исследовательского отдела. \
Вы занимаетесь научными аспектами миссии и отвечаете за корпоративные интересы Организации Экспедиционного корпуса. \
Expand Down Expand Up @@ -189,8 +185,6 @@
/datum/computer_file/program/camera_monitor,
/datum/computer_file/program/reports)

intro_music = list('proxima/sound/intro/cmo1.ogg')

/datum/job/cmo/get_description_blurb()
return "Вы - Главный медицинский офицер (СМО или ГМО). Вы отвечаете за работу медицинского отдела. Вы гарантируете, что все работники отдела хорошо обученны, подготовленны и что они выполняют свои обязанности. \
Убедитесь, что ваши врачи укомплектовали ваш лазарет, а ваши санитары/парамедики готовы к реагированию. \
Expand Down Expand Up @@ -301,8 +295,6 @@
/datum/computer_file/program/camera_monitor,
/datum/computer_file/program/reports)

intro_music = list('proxima/sound/intro/hos1.ogg')

/datum/job/hos/get_description_blurb()
return "Вы - Глава службы безопасности (ГСБ). Вы отвечаете за охрану судна, равно как и за каптенармусов, смотрителя и криминалистов. \
Вы поддерживаете порядок на судне, а также отвечаете за внешнюю и внутренную безопасность. Вы - закон. Вы подчиняетесь КО и ИО. \
Expand Down Expand Up @@ -407,8 +399,6 @@
alt_titles = list("Military Lawyer")
software_on_spawn = list(/datum/computer_file/program/reports)

intro_music = list('proxima/sound/intro/lawyer1.ogg')

/datum/job/representative/get_description_blurb()
return "Вы - Военный прокурор. Консультруйте экипаж по вопросам закона. \
Рассматривайте апелляции гражданских и военнослужащих. \
Expand Down Expand Up @@ -505,8 +495,6 @@

alt_titles = list("Adjutant","Helmsman","Coordination Officer","Command Secretary") //PRX

intro_music = list('proxima/sound/intro/officer1.ogg')

access = list(
access_security, access_medical, access_engine, access_maint_tunnels, access_emergency_storage,
access_bridge, access_janitor, access_kitchen, access_cargo, access_mailsorting, access_RC_announce, access_keycard_auth,
Expand Down
4 changes: 0 additions & 4 deletions maps/torch/job/engineering_jobs.dm
Original file line number Diff line number Diff line change
Expand Up @@ -48,8 +48,6 @@
/datum/computer_file/program/camera_monitor,
/datum/computer_file/program/shields_monitor)

intro_music = list('proxima/sound/intro/engineer1.ogg')

/datum/job/senior_engineer/get_description_blurb()
return "Вы - Старший инженер (СИ). Вы опытный старший унтер-офицер. Вам подчиняется остальной отдел, за исключением Главного инженера. \
Вы должны быть экспертом практически в каждом инженерном деле, а также быть знакомым с лидерскими качествами и владеть ими. \
Expand Down Expand Up @@ -120,8 +118,6 @@
/datum/computer_file/program/camera_monitor,
/datum/computer_file/program/shields_monitor)

intro_music = list('proxima/sound/intro/engineer1.ogg')

/datum/job/engineer/get_description_blurb()
return "Вы - инженер. Вы работаете под одним из множества названий и можете быть высокоспециализированны в определённой области инженернии. \
Возможно, что у Вы хотя бы в общем знакомы с большинством остальных областей инженерии, хотя это не ожидается от Вас."
Expand Down
12 changes: 0 additions & 12 deletions maps/torch/job/exploration_jobs.dm
Original file line number Diff line number Diff line change
Expand Up @@ -39,8 +39,6 @@
software_on_spawn = list(/datum/computer_file/program/deck_management,
/datum/computer_file/program/reports)

intro_music = list('proxima/sound/intro/explorers1.ogg', 'proxima/sound/intro/explorers2.ogg')

/datum/job/pathfinder/get_description_blurb()
return "Вы - Первопроходец. Ваша обязанность - организовывать и вести экспедиции в удалённые места, выполняя Главную Миссию ЭК. \
Вы командуете Исследователями и Морпехами. Присматривайте за тем, чтобы Ваши мужщины и женщины не потратили всю энергию шаттла на зарядку батарей. \
Expand Down Expand Up @@ -87,8 +85,6 @@
max_skill = list( SKILL_PILOT = SKILL_MAX,
SKILL_SCIENCE = SKILL_MAX)

intro_music = list('proxima/sound/intro/explorers1.ogg', 'proxima/sound/intro/explorers2.ogg')

/datum/job/nt_pilot/get_description_blurb()
return "Вы - пилот экспедиции. Ваша задача - обслуживать Харон и управлять им. Вы подчиняетесь Первопроходцу. Удостоверьтесь, что Харон имеет топливо в баках, а также энергию для полёта. \
Не забывайте приглядывать за остальной командой."
Expand Down Expand Up @@ -128,8 +124,6 @@

software_on_spawn = list(/datum/computer_file/program/deck_management)

intro_music = list('proxima/sound/intro/explorers1.ogg', 'proxima/sound/intro/explorers2.ogg')

/datum/job/explorer/get_description_blurb()
return "Вы - Исследователь. Ваша задача - участвовать в экспедициях в удалённые места. Первопроходец - лидер Вашей команды. \
Вы должны искать все, что представляет экономический или научный интерес для ЦПСС - месторождения полезных ископаемых, инопланетную флору/фауну, артефакты. \
Expand Down Expand Up @@ -179,8 +173,6 @@
software_on_spawn = list(/datum/computer_file/program/suit_sensors,
/datum/computer_file/program/deck_management)

intro_music = list('proxima/sound/intro/explorers1.ogg', 'proxima/sound/intro/explorers2.ogg')

/datum/job/expmed/get_description_blurb()
return "Вы - Исследователь-медик. Ваша задача - участвовать в экспедициях в удалённые места. Первопроходец - лидер Вашей команды. \
Ваша цель - лечение и спасение остальных участников экспедиции. Учтите, что вы не профессиональный хирург, поэтому не пытайтесь проводить операции на шаттле, у Вас нет квалификации для этого."
Expand Down Expand Up @@ -228,8 +220,6 @@

software_on_spawn = list(/datum/computer_file/program/deck_management)

intro_music = list('proxima/sound/intro/explorers1.ogg', 'proxima/sound/intro/explorers2.ogg')

/datum/job/expeng/get_description_blurb()
return "Вы - Исследователь-инженер. Ваша задача - участвовать в экспедициях в удалённые места. Первопроходец - лидер Вашей команды. \
Ваша цель - поддерживать шаттл в рабочем состоянии и проделывать проходы везде, где скажет ваш босс."
Expand Down Expand Up @@ -274,8 +264,6 @@

software_on_spawn = list(/datum/computer_file/program/deck_management)

intro_music = list('proxima/sound/intro/explorers1.ogg', 'proxima/sound/intro/explorers2.ogg')

/datum/job/expinf/get_description_blurb()
return "Вы - охранник экспедиции. Ваша задача - участвовать в экспедициях в удалённые места и обеспечивать безопасность экспедиции. Первопроходец - лидер Вашей команды. \
Слушайте его и повинуйтесь любой ценой. Постарайтесь не растратить весь запас батарей."
2 changes: 0 additions & 2 deletions maps/torch/job/medical_jobs.dm
Original file line number Diff line number Diff line change
Expand Up @@ -255,8 +255,6 @@
access_virology, access_morgue, access_crematorium, access_radio_med
)

intro_music = list('proxima/sound/intro/chemist1.ogg')

/datum/job/chemist/get_description_blurb()
return "Вы - Фармацевт. Вы изготавливаете медицину и другие полезные субстанции. Вы не доктор или медик. Вам не следует лечить пациентов, вы должны предоставлять медицину для их лечения. \
Вы подчиняетесь Врачам и Парамедикам (в случае, если Вы контрактник, то ещё и Корпоративному связному)."
Expand Down
1 change: 0 additions & 1 deletion maps/torch/job/misc_jobs.dm
Original file line number Diff line number Diff line change
Expand Up @@ -63,7 +63,6 @@ Civilian
)
min_goals = 2
max_goals = 7
intro_music = list('proxima/sound/intro/assistant1.ogg')

/datum/job/assistant/get_description_blurb()
return "Вы - пассажир. Вы находитесь на Государственном Экспедиционном Корабле \"Факел\", который принадлежит Экспедиционному корпусу - научному агенству ЦПСС. \
Expand Down
2 changes: 0 additions & 2 deletions maps/torch/job/research_jobs.dm
Original file line number Diff line number Diff line change
Expand Up @@ -42,7 +42,6 @@
SKILL_SCIENCE = SKILL_MAX)
skill_points = 20
possible_goals = list(/datum/goal/achievement/notslimefodder)
intro_music = list('proxima/sound/intro/research3.ogg')

/datum/job/senior_scientist/get_description_blurb()
return "Вы - Старший научный сотрудник. Ваша задача - обеспечивать учёных работой и заниматся исследованием различных областей науки. \
Expand Down Expand Up @@ -97,7 +96,6 @@
)
skill_points = 20
possible_goals = list(/datum/goal/achievement/notslimefodder)
intro_music = list('proxima/sound/intro/research1.ogg', 'proxima/sound/intro/research2.ogg')

/datum/job/scientist/get_description_blurb()
return "Вы - Научный сотрудник. Ваша задача - проводить анализ различных вещей и проверять свои гипотизы на практике. \
Expand Down
48 changes: 24 additions & 24 deletions proxima/code/game/objects/effects/particles/snow.dm
Original file line number Diff line number Diff line change
@@ -1,24 +1,24 @@
/particles/snow //byond ref code, lol
width = 500
height = 500
count = 2500
spawning = 12
bound1 = list(-1000, -300, -1000)
lifespan = 600
fade = 50
position = generator("box", list(-300,250,0), list(300,300,50))
gravity = list(0, -1)
friction = 0.3
drift = generator("sphere", 0, 2)

/obj/screenfilter/snow
mouse_opacity = 0
screen_loc = "CENTER"
particles = new/particles/snow

/obj/screenfilter/snow/Fade()
animate(src, alpha=0, time=10) //i've spent too much time to make this shit pass unit tests
..()

/obj/screenfilter/proc/Fade() //overwrite to create cool fading effects :call_me:
qdel(src)
/particles/snow //byond ref code, lol
width = 500
height = 500
count = 2500
spawning = 12
bound1 = list(-1000, -300, -1000)
lifespan = 600
fade = 50
position = generator("box", list(-300,250,0), list(300,300,50))
gravity = list(0, -1)
friction = 0.3
drift = generator("sphere", 0, 2)

/obj/screenfilter/snow
mouse_opacity = 0
screen_loc = "CENTER"
particles = new/particles/snow

/obj/screenfilter/snow/Fade()
animate(src, alpha=0, time=10) //i've spent too much time to make this shit pass unit tests
..()

/obj/screenfilter/proc/Fade() //overwrite to create cool fading effects :call_me:
qdel(src)
Binary file removed proxima/sound/intro/assistant1.ogg
Binary file not shown.
Binary file removed proxima/sound/intro/captain1.ogg
Binary file not shown.
Binary file removed proxima/sound/intro/chemist1.ogg
Binary file not shown.
Binary file removed proxima/sound/intro/cmo1.ogg
Binary file not shown.
Binary file removed proxima/sound/intro/engineer1.ogg
Binary file not shown.
Binary file removed proxima/sound/intro/explorers1.ogg
Binary file not shown.
Binary file removed proxima/sound/intro/explorers2.ogg
Binary file not shown.
Binary file removed proxima/sound/intro/hos1.ogg
Binary file not shown.
Binary file removed proxima/sound/intro/lawyer1.ogg
Binary file not shown.
Binary file removed proxima/sound/intro/officer1.ogg
Binary file not shown.
Binary file removed proxima/sound/intro/rd1.ogg
Binary file not shown.
Binary file removed proxima/sound/intro/research1.ogg
Binary file not shown.
Binary file removed proxima/sound/intro/research2.ogg
Binary file not shown.
Binary file removed proxima/sound/intro/research3.ogg
Binary file not shown.

0 comments on commit dd87e4c

Please sign in to comment.